Transaction 3dfe11421c701272315548f29b95e3ad89ec25773c35af0ed0d650a0a10340a3

2 Input
2 Outputs
  • 3dfe11421c701272315548f29b95e3ad89ec25773c35af0ed0d650a0a10340a3:0
  • value  505083
    address  13hzxCK4V83UtmWvRzqYrspV1pvJvgaMUx
  • 3dfe11421c701272315548f29b95e3ad89ec25773c35af0ed0d650a0a10340a3:1
  • value  1518132
    address  1HEXg79Dgw9yhfWktFjkjcS4b85QtUnv35